Compatibility with brake system
When choosing brake pads for your mountain bike, matching the pads to your caliper type is fundamental since different calipers require specific pad shapes and mounting styles to function correctly. Paying attention to rotor size and thickness is also important because larger or thicker rotors often demand more durable or specially designed pads to provide consistent stopping power and prevent premature wear. Consulting manufacturer recommendations and selecting model-specific pads can help maintain compatibility and safety, as brands typically design their brake components to work harmoniously, improving overall performance and longevity of your braking system.
Making sure these factors align will lead to a smoother and more reliable ride on various terrains.
Weather and riding conditions
When searching for the best mountain bike brake pads, consider how they perform under different weather and riding conditions to get the most reliable stopping power. Brake pads designed for wet conditions typically feature materials that maintain friction even when soaked, providing confident braking during rainy rides.
On the other hand, pads optimized for dry conditions often last longer and offer consistent performance on dusty or dry trails. Resistance to mud, dust, and debris plays a significant role in maintaining braking efficiency; pads with special compounds or grooves help shed grime and prevent buildup, keeping brakes responsive. Depending on the climate where most of your riding takes place, choosing pads that can handle temperature fluctuations and varying moisture levels will enhance durability and safety.
Selecting brake pads that balance performance across these factors results in better control and a more enjoyable mountain biking experience in diverse environments.

Brake pad material types
Organic brake pads usually consist of softer materials like rubber and resin, offering quieter performance and gentle wear on rotors but may wear out faster and struggle under wet or muddy conditions. Metallic pads include metal particles, providing stronger braking power and better heat dissipation, which makes them suitable for aggressive riding and steep descents; however, they can be noisier and cause more rotor wear. Sintered pads are made by fusing metallic particles under high heat and pressure, delivering excellent durability and performance in various weather conditions, although they tend to be the noisiest and might be harder on rotors compared to organic options.
When choosing among these types, consider your typical riding environment and style, as organic pads work well for casual riders who prioritize smooth and quiet braking, while metallic or sintered pads are often preferred by riders tackling technical terrains or requiring consistent stopping power under demanding conditions. Balancing factors such as noise level, rotor lifespan, and braking efficiency helps achieve a satisfying ride tailored to individual needs.
Noise and modulation
When choosing the best mountain bike brake pads, paying attention to how they affect noise and modulation can greatly enhance your riding experience. Brake squeal and noise often occur due to factors such as contamination from dirt or oil, the type of pad material, or improper alignment between the pads and rotors. Smoothness of braking control depends on the pad’s ability to provide consistent friction without abrupt grabs, which makes descending steep trails or navigating technical sections feel more secure and manageable.
Smoothness of braking control depends on the pad’s ability to provide consistent friction without abrupt grabs, which makes descending steep trails or navigating technical sections feel more secure and manageable. Adjusting pads to reduce noise generally involves fine-tuning their position and ensuring that the rotor is clean and free of debris. Slightly angling the pads, known as toeing in, can help minimize vibrations that cause squealing sounds.
Opting for pads made from materials suited to your riding conditions, whether resin for quieter operation or metallic for durability and stronger stopping power, also influences noise levels and modulation.
